Start the day at Monte Brasil, enjoying a panoramic view over the city of Angra do Heroísmo. We continue along the coast to the Serretinha viewpoint, where you can see the Ilhéus das Cabras, passing through the parishes of Ribeirinha and Feteira.
After passing through the village of Porto Judeu, continue to Baía da Salga, a historic landmark in the history of Portugal.
Head a little further inland and enjoy the tranquility of the village of São Sebastião, where you will find one of the oldest churches in the Azores.
Continue to Serra do Cume and prepare to be amazed by the view of the “Manta de Retalhos” (Patchwork Quilt) in the largest caldera in the Azores.
After a lunch break in the city of Praia da Vitória, continue the adventure with a climb up Serra do Facho, where the view over the city is breathtaking.
Optionally, head inland and descend into the impressive volcanic cave of Algar do Carvão*.
Before ending the day at the natural pools of Biscoitos, surrounded by characteristic lava rock formations, from which the famous vineyards also spring, you can enjoy a refreshing dip.
